Hi, the emerging Qt Project would like to organize a Qt Contribution day
on Dec 29 during "Qt Dev Days":http://qt.nokia.com/qtdevdays2011/ in San
Francisco. The goal is to have an unconference setup open to Qt
contributors in order to discuss tasks and contributions related to the
Qt Project, modules maintenance, involvement in teams...

This type of meetings started last June with the big and intense
(according to all records) "Qt Contributors
Summit":http://developer.qt.nokia.com/groups/qt_contributors_summit/wiki
in Berlin. Qt DevDays in Munich will also have a Qt Contribution day and
it is a good idea to keep this practice wherever the is a good
concentration of Qt contributors.
